* تفسير Tanwîr al-Miqbâs min Tafsîr Ibn ‘Abbâs


{ وَٱصْبِرْ نَفْسَكَ مَعَ ٱلَّذِينَ يَدْعُونَ رَبَّهُم بِٱلْغَدَاةِ وَٱلْعَشِيِّ يُرِيدُونَ وَجْهَهُ وَلاَ تَعْدُ عَيْنَاكَ عَنْهُمْ تُرِيدُ زِينَةَ ٱلْحَيَاةِ ٱلدُّنْيَا وَلاَ تُطِعْ مَنْ أَغْفَلْنَا قَلْبَهُ عَن ذِكْرِنَا وَٱتَّبَعَ هَوَاهُ وَكَانَ أَمْرُهُ فُرُطاً }

(Restrain thyself along with those who cry unto their Lord) who worship their Lord (at morn and evening) the reference here is to Salman al-Farisi and his fellow believers, (seeking His Countenance) by worshipping Him they seek only Allah's Countenance and good pleasure; (and let not your eyes overlook them, desiring the pomp of the life of the world) the embellishment of this worldly life; (and obey not him whose heart We have made heedless of Our remembrance) of Our divine Oneness, (who followeth his own lust) by worshipping the idols (and whose case) and whose words (hath been abandoned) at a loss. This verse was revealed about 'Uyaynah Ibn Hisn al-Fazari.
